  • Conversations: Alex Kurzman & Noga Landau
    Jan 13 2026
    In this Conversations segment, Star Trek: Starfleet Academy showrunners Alex Kurtzman and Noga Landau sit down to discuss the vision behind the franchise’s boldest evolution yet.

    Set in the 32nd century, Starfleet Academy shifts the focus from command chairs to classrooms, asking how Starfleet’s values are taught, tested, and sometimes challenged by a new generation. Kurtzman and Landau break down why this was the right moment to tell an Academy story, how skepticism and failure are built into the show’s DNA, and why optimism still matters in a future shaped by uncertainty.

  • Conversations: Starfleet Academy Castmembers
    Jan 13 2026
    In this Conversations segment, Star Trek: Starfleet Academy cast members Robert Picardo, Tig Notaro, and Gina Yashere sit down to discuss legacy, leadership, and why discomfort is sometimes the best teacher. From Picardo’s Doctor carrying centuries of memory, to Notaro’s no-nonsense Jett Reno, to Yashere’s formidable Lura Thok, the trio breaks down how this new era of Star Trek balances humor, discipline, and hope.

    It’s a candid, thoughtful look at shaping the next generation of Starfleet, on screen and off.

  • Conversations: Christy Martin
    Nov 13 2025
    In this exclusive interview, we sit down with boxing icon Christy Martin, writer-director Mirrah Foulkes, and producer David Michôd to discuss Christy, the powerful new biopic exploring Martin’s extraordinary rise, survival, and legacy.

    We dive into the true story behind the “Coal Miner’s Daughter,” the emotional process of revisiting Christy’s past, the filmmaking challenges of adapting real-life trauma, and why this film aims to honor both the fighter and the woman behind the gloves.
